Sound waves may help chemotherapy reach Kids' brain tumors
NCT ID NCT05293197
First seen Nov 20, 2025 · Last updated Apr 30, 2026 · Updated 15 times
Summary
This early-stage study tests whether a special ultrasound device can safely open the blood-brain barrier in children with hard-to-treat brain tumors. The goal is to let chemotherapy reach the tumor more effectively. About 24 children aged 5 to 17 will receive ultrasound before their chemo drug, carboplatin.
